Applies to

This KB applies primarily to the HCI nodes types below:

  • HCI Compute Nodes
    • H410C
    • H610C
    • H615C
    • H300E/H500E/H700E (deprecated; now H410C)
  • HCI Flash Storage Node
    • H610S

Note, however, that the RTFI process also applies to these non-HCI nodes running Element Software:

  • SF Series Storage Nodes
    • SF3010/SF6010/SF9010 (legacy, EOA)
    • SF2405/SF4805/SF9605/SF19210/SF38410 (EOA)
  • FC Series Fibre Channel Nodes
    • FCN001 (EOA)
    • FC025 (EOA)
  • HCI Deployment Engine/Monitoring Agent

Issue

When performing a RTFI using a USB key, you received the error:

No valid Solidfire image found
